Genesee Country Village and Museum and the Girl Scouts of Genesee Valley invite you to join us at the museum for a celebration of Juliette Low’s birthday and local women’s “her-story.” 
Spend the day at the Museum learning about non-traditional women and experiencing traditional activities from the 1800s and early 1900s.  Did you know Rochester had a women’s baseball team back in the 1860s?  Learn about women’s roles in the 1800s, play games, participate in contests, explore the houses, learn how to spin, write with a quill and ink, enjoy lunch, learn a new song and have a Closing Tea with cookies made from the original Girl Scout Cookie recipe!
